Keune Haircosmetics has released “Between Past and Present,” a new seasonal collection for Fall and Winter 2013-2014. The wide-ranging styles encompass iconic looks of past decades that are easily transferable to today’s fashion conscious client.

Christian Faircloth, education/creative director for Keune North America, sees hair fashion trending toward minimalist elegance with tone-on-tone color and a return to loose, symmetrical layers that favor natural wave and movement.
